look up any word, like sparkle pony:
Someone who is always cleaning all day long without or with little breaks in between.
Hey did you know my mom is a cleanaholic? No but how come?
Because she clean the house all day!
by Happyman2642 March 10, 2009

Words related to cleanaholic

addicted aholic all clean day house mom